WebThe left figure (Fig.3-1) shows a measurement result of a semiconductor device plotted on a time series. If the same semiconductor object is repeatedly measured with a metrology system, the measurement result should always be the same. But in reality, measurement values vary depending on the disturbance and noise. http://ruppersberger.house.gov/sites/evo-subsites/ruppersberger.house.gov/files/evo-media-document/morgan-state-microelectronics-nexus-letter.pdf WebA Critical Dimension SEM ( CD-SEM: Critical Dimension Scanning Electron Microscope) is a dedicated system for measuring the dimensions of the fine patterns formed on a semiconductor wafer. CD-SEM is mainly used in the manufacturing lines of electronic devices of semiconductors. Three main CD-SEM features that differ from the general …

Web2. CD-AFM LINEWIDTH METROLOGY There are many important metrology applications of CD-AFM in semiconductor manufacturing. However, the most common is linewidth metrology for measurement of gate CD or as a reference tool for in-line critical dimension scanning electron microscopes (CD-SEMs). bu100re バッテリー交換Web1.
